How SketchUp works

• Clever user interface for extruding 2D objects

• Great for architectural stuff (cubes, cylinders, pyramids, etc)

• It is based on edges and planes, not volumes

• Not so great for free-form objects, but….

• http://sketchup.google.com/products.html

How to Make a 3D Geological Model

1. Make sequential cross sections with kinky geometry2. Interpret both above and below the ground3. Export to SketchUp as .dxf together with 2D map4. Put each geological unit in a SketchUp layer5. Hide all layers but one6. Join the cross sections to form a surface7. Repeat for all your units8. Import the DEM9. Intersect the 3D model and the DEM10. Optional: add colors, textures, etc.
